The Heavy Equipment Mechanic Lead (HEML) works under the direction of the Maintenance Supervisor and is responsible for overseeing the daily maintenance operations of construction equipment, military vehicles, and small engine systems. The HEML will lead and coordinate the efforts of mechanics, clerks, and inspectors, ensuring efficient execution of maintenance activities and a high standard of customer service. This includes supervising equipment inspections, diagnosing faults, performing troubleshooting procedures, and verifying that all repairs are conducted in accordance with applicable standards. The HEML is also responsible for using the Automated Logistics Information System to manage maintenance records and ensure timely service. Safety, quality control, and attention to detail must be maintained at all times. On occasion, the HEML may be required to perform hands-on repair tasks, assess wear and damage on components, and replace or rebuild parts as necessary to maintain the operational readiness of supported equipment.

Working Environment :
Work is generally conducted in a shop environment. However, duties may involve the conduct of work in the outdoors area with a potential exposure to extreme climatic conditions. Work requires stooping, climbing, prolonged standing, prolonged sitting, and occasional working in cramped and awkward positions. Frequent exposure to conditions of inclement weather, extreme heat and cold, high / low humidity, blowing sand and dust, and working in confined spaces and at heights. The worker is subject to atmospheric conditions that affect the respiratory system and skin : fumes, odors, dust, mists, gases, or poor ventilation.
Physical Requirements :
Must be able to climb up and down ladders and stairs, as well as bend, twist, and squat for prolonged periods. Must be able to pull, push, and lift up to 50 pounds. Visual acuity is required to operate motor vehicles and / or heavy equipment.
Material & Equipment Used :
Extensive use of basic shop equipment, diagnostic equipment, hand tools, power tools, air tools, and lifting devices. Applicant must provide their own tools (general mechanics tool set) that are OSHA compliance and are subject to inspection upon arrival. Steel toe shoes are required. Personal protective equipment (PPE) is required in certain areas while work is being conducted.
